C语言入门篇--变量[定义|C语言入门篇--变量[定义,初始化赋值,外部声明]
1.变量
变量即变化的量。
C语言中用 常量 来表示不变的值,用 变量 表示变化的值。
eg:输出26个字母
#include int main(){ char c = 'A'; //定义一个为char类型的变量c,并对其进行初始化 for (; c <='Z'; c++) {printf("%c", c); } printf("\n"); return 0; }
文章图片
2.变量的定义
int temp; int age = 21; float weight = 51.2f; char ch = 'V';
2.1变量定义格式
int a = 10;2.2定义变量本质
格式:
类型 变量名 赋值操作符 内容
在计算机内存中开辟对应变量大小的空间。
2.3注意
一个变量在一个代码块内,只能定义一次。
3.变量的初始化与赋值 初始化:
在定义变量时为其赋值。赋值:
eg: int age = 21;
为已存在的变量赋上新的值。注意:
eg: age=22;
float weight = 45.5f;
表示float类型的浮点数时建议带上f,double类型不用带。
int temp;4.变量的分类 变量的分类
若定义变量时为未初始化,系统会为其赋一个随机值。
5.变量的属性 在看此块内容前可以先看看内存及地址相关内容,更容易理解。
一个变量是有三个属性:
1.变量的空间。
2.变量的内容。
【C语言入门篇--变量[定义|C语言入门篇--变量[定义,初始化赋值,外部声明]】3.变量的地址。
为了解释清楚,请移步---->变量的属性、变量的左值与右值
6.变量的外部声明 1.变量的声明可以有多次
变量的声明是告诉文件在某个地方有某变量,程序在连接时可以找到。
extern 变量的类型 变量名一般在声明变量时只需写变量的类型和变量名,不需要写上具体值。
2.函数外部声明
extern 函数名一般在声明函数时只需写函数名,不用写函数体。
以上就是C语言入门篇--变量[定义,属性,外部声明]的详细内容,更多关于C语言的资料请关注脚本之家其它相关文章!
推荐阅读
- 2018年11月19日|2018年11月19日 星期一 亲子日记第144篇
- 《魔法科高中的劣等生》第26卷(Invasion篇)发售
- 拍照一年啦,如果你想了解我,那就请先看看这篇文章
- 【生信技能树】R语言练习题|【生信技能树】R语言练习题 - 中级
- 亲子日记第186篇,2018、7、26、星期四、晴
- 一起来学习C语言的字符串转换函数
- C语言字符函数中的isalnum()和iscntrl()你都知道吗
- C语言浮点函数中的modf和fmod详解
- C语言中的时间函数clock()和time()你都了解吗
- 漫画初学者如何学习漫画背景的透视画法(这篇教程请收藏好了!)